Sie sind auf Seite 1von 65

PROGRAMACIN

LINEAL
Objetivos
Conocer la utilidad de la programacin
lineal en problemas de optimizacin.
Dominar el lenguaje propio de la
programacin lineal.
Encontrar y representar regiones factibles y
soluciones ptimas mediante el mtodo
grfico.
Utilizar el comando solver para la
resolucin de problemas de programacin
lineal.

Conocimientos Previos
Las clases estarn dirigidas a alumnos
correspondientes al 5
to
ao de
educacin media o 1
er
ao
universitario con orientacin en
Administracin de empresas, que
contengan los siguientes saberes
previos:
Representacin grfica de rectas y de
desigualdades en el plano cartesiano.
Resolucin de sistemas de ecuaciones
lineales mediante regla de Cramer.



CLASE 1
CLASE 2
Introduccin a la
programacin lineal,
mtodo grfico de
optimizacin
Mtodo del punto
esquina, comando
Solver.
Contenidos:
Introduccin a la Programacin Lineal
Lenguaje de Programacin
Situacin Inicial
Mtodo Grfico

CLASE 1
De dnde proviene el trmino
Programacin Lineal?
La parte de programacin del nombre
proviene de la terminologa militar de la era de
la segunda guerra mundial. Cada programa
era una solucin a un problema de asignacin
de recursos, como por ejemplo Qu programa
de distribucin de combustible contribuir
mejor a la victoria global?
La programacin entendida de esta manera es
una gran herramienta de investigacin de
operaciones y el trmino lineal hace
referencia a que un problema se pueda
describir utilizando ecuaciones y desigualdades
lineales.

Para que sirve la
programacin lineal?
Lenguaje de Programacin
Funcin
Objetivo
Restricciones
Soluciones
Factibles
Solucin
ptima
Es la funcin por
maximizar o minimizar
Son las limitaciones
existentes sobre las
variables. Constituyen un
sistema de desigualdades.
Son las infinitas soluciones
para el sistema de
restricciones.
Es una de las soluciones
factibles que le da valor
mximo o mnimo a la
funcin objetivo.
... Recordemos un
poco
Cul de los siguientes regiones
coloreadas en el grfico corresponde a
la desigualdad ?
1
5 3
x y
+ s
Cul es la opcin correcta?
Regin
Celeste
Regin
Violeta
INCORRECTO!!!
Debs revisar algunos
conceptos previos antes
de continuarVolv a
pensarlo
CONTINUAR
MUY BIEN!!!
Ya ests en condiciones
de comenzar a ver de qu
se trata la programacin
lineal
SITUACIN INICIAL
Un fabricante produce dos tipos de corbatas, Old Smokey
y Blaze Away. Para su produccin, las corbatas
requieren del uso de dos mquinas de coser A y B. El
nmero de horas necesarias para ambas esta indicado en
la siguiente tabla:

Mquina
A
Mquina
B
Old
Smokey
2 h 4 h
Blaze
Away
4 h 2 h
Si cada mquina puede utilizarse 24 horas por da y las
utilidades en los modelos son de $4 y $6 respectivamente.
Cuntas corbatas de cada tipo deben producirse por da
para obtener una utilidad mxima? Cul es la utilidad
mxima?
Planteo del problema
Funcin
Objetivo
Restricciones
4 6 Z x y = +
2 4 24
4 2 24
0
0
x y
x y
x
y
+ s

+ s

>

>

Es la funcin de
utilidades que
debo maximizar
Limitaciones
horarias de las
mquinas A y B
Condiciones
de no
negatividad
Pasos a seguir para encontrar la cantidad de
artculos que deben venderse, de ambos modelos,
para que la utilidad sea mxima:
1. Graficar las desigualdades que
indican las restricciones del
problema en el plano cartesiano.
2. Indicar la interseccin de dichas
regiones, o sea, la solucin al
sistema de inecuaciones planteado
(Regin de soluciones factibles).
3. Encontrar en el interior de esa
regin, cul es el punto para en el
cual la funcin de utilidades
(Funcin objetivo) es mxima.

Cmo encontramos la regin
de soluciones factibles?
A continuacin
graficaremos paso a
paso las restricciones
del problema.
Condicin de no negatividad:
0, 0 x y > >
Regin
excluida
Solucin
Recta
incluida en
la solucin
Primera Restriccin:

2 4 24 x y + <
Recta
excluida de
la solucin
Segunda Restriccin: 4 2 24 x y + <
Regin de
soluciones
factibles
Para encontrar la
solucin ptima
podemos utilizar
Mtodo grfico
Mtodo del punto
esquina
Comando Solver
Mtodo Grfico
La recta se llama recta de
isoutilidad debido a que todos sus puntos tienen la
misma utilidad, su pendiente es -2/3 y su ordenada al
origen vara segn el valor de la utilidad Z.
El mtodo grfico consiste en buscar cul de estas
rectas de isoutilidad cumple con dos condiciones:

Tiene puntos en comn con la regin de soluciones
factibles.
Tiene ordenada al origen mxima.

2
4 6
3 6
Z
Z x y y x = + =
Busc la recta de isoutilidad
mxima en Excel dndole
diferentes valores a la variable
Z (Utilidad):
Microsoft Excel
En qu punto de la regin de
soluciones factibles la utilidad es
mxima?
A
D
B
Ninguno de
los anteriores
C
INCORRECTO!!!

Volv a excel e intentalo de
nuevo
Microsoft Excel
VOLVER
MUY BIEN!!!
Veamos entonces el
grfico que contiene a la
regin de soluciones
factibles y a la recta de
utilidad mxima
Recta de
Utilidad
Mxima
A
B
C D
Cualquier recta de
isoutilidad con una
utilidad mayor no
contendr puntos en
la regin factible.
Encontremos las coordenadas
del punto B
Resolv el sistema de ecuaciones



en excel mediante la regla de Cramer
utilizando determinantes
2 4 24
4 2 24
x y
x y
+ =

+ =

Microsoft Excel
Interpretemos el resultado
Cul de las siguientes conclusiones sera la correcta?

Cuando se produzcan 40 unidades de cada producto la
utilidad ser mxima y ser de $4 por unidad.

Cuando se produzcan 4 unidades de corbatas Old
Smokey y 4 unidades de corbatas Blaze Away la utilidad
ser mxima y ser de $40.

Cuando se produzcan 40 unidades de cada marca a un
precio unitario de $4 la utilidad ser mxima.

INCORRECTO!!!

Volv a pensarlo
VOLVER
MUY BIEN!!!
B

Las ganancias
sern
mximas y
sern de $40
cuando se
produzcan 4
corbatas Old
Smokey y 4
corbatas Blaze
Away.
FI N
CLASE 2
Contenidos:
Mtodo del punto esquina.
Minimizacin en una regin factible no
acotada.
Comando Solver.



Mtodo del Punto Esquina
Como pudimos observar en el mtodo grfico la recta
de utilidad mxima encontrada contiene a un vrtice de
la regin factible (punto esquina). Por lo tanto podemos
deducir que:
Una funcin lineal definida sobre
una regin factible acotada no
vaca, tiene un valor mximo
(mnimo) que puede hallarse en un
vrtice (punto extremo, esquina)
Para mostrarlo recurriremos a la situacin
problemtica de la clase anterior, te invito a Excel a
buscar el valor mximo en los cuatro puntos
esquina: A, B, C y D.
Microsoft Excel
A
D
B
Ninguno de
los anteriores
C
En cul de los puntos la funcin
objetivo encuentra su mximo valor?
INCORRECTO!!!

Volv a pensarlo
VOLVER
MUY BIEN!!!
B
El resultado
coincide
con el obtenido
en la clase
anterior.
Veamos otro ejemplo
Pero esta vez en una regin factible no acotada.
Es decir que la regin no estar encerrada por una
figura como en el ejemplo anterior
Costo Mnimo
Un agricultor va a comprar fertilizante que contienen tres
nutrientes: A, B y C. Los mnimos necesarios son 160 unidades de
A, 200 unidades de B y 80 unidades de C. Existen dos marcas muy
aceptadas de fertilizantes en el mercado. Crece Rpido cuesta $8
la bolsa, contiene 3 unidades de A, 5 unidades de B y 1 unidad de
C. Crece Fcil cuesta $6 cada bolsa y contiene 2 unidades de cada
nutrimento. Si el cultivador desea minimizar el costo mientras se
satisfacen los requerimientos de nutrimentos, Cuntas bolsas de
cada marca debe comprar?
A B C Costo / Bolsa
Crece Rpido 3 u 5 u 1 u $ 8
Crece Fcil 2 u 2 u 2 u $ 6
Unidades
Requeridas
160 200 80
Planteo del Problema
8 6 C x y = +
3 2 160
5 2 200
2 80
0
0
x y
x y
x y
x
y
+ >

+ >

+ >

>

>

Es la funcin de
costo que debo
minimizar
Condiciones
de no
negatividad
Funcin
Objetivo
Restricciones
Regin de Soluciones Factibles
5 2 200 x y + =
2 80 x y + =
3 2 160 x y + =
A
B
C
D
Regin de
soluciones
factibles
Para poder aplicar el mtodo del punto esquina debemos
encontrar todos los vrtices, observando el grfico:
A = (0,100) y D = (80,0)

Te invito a Excel a resolver los siguientes sistemas de
ecuaciones mediante la regla de Cramer:

Punto B



Punto C
3 2 160
5 2 200
x y
x y
+ =

+ =

3 2 160
2 80
x y
x y
+ =

+ =

Microsoft Excel
Encontremos los puntos Esquina
Ahora vamos nuevamente a Excel a reemplazar los
cuatro puntos esquina en la funcin objetivo:
A = (0,100) B = (20,50) C = (40,20) y D = (80,0)
Microsoft Excel
A
D
B
Ninguno de
los anteriores
C
En cul de los puntos la funcin
objetivo encuentra su mnimo valor?
INCORRECTO!!!

Volv a Excel e intentalo de
nuevo
Microsoft Excel
VOLVER
MUY BIEN!!!
Veamos entonces el
grfico que contiene a la
regin de soluciones
factibles y a la recta de
costo mnimo
A
B
C
D
Recta
de
isocosto
mnimo
Respuesta al Problema de Minimizacin de Costos
El agricultor
deber comprar
40 bolsas de la
marca Crece
Rpido y 20
bolsas de la
marca Crece
Fcil para
lograr minimizar
los costos en
$440.
Otro mtodo para resolver
problemas de programacin lineal
utilizando Excel
Comando Solver
Microsoft Excel
Una compaa fabrica tres tipos de muebles para patio: sillas,
mecedoras y sillones. Cada uno requiere madera, plstico y
aluminio como se muestra en la siguiente tabla:







La compaa tiene disponibles 400 unidades de madera, 500
unidades de plstico y 1450 unidades de aluminio. Cada silla,
mecedora y silln se vende en $21, $24 y $36, respectivamente.
Suponiendo que todos los mubles pueden venderse determine,
utilizando el mtodo simplex, la produccin para que el ingreso
total sea mximo. Cul es el ingreso mximo?
Madera Plstico Aluminio
Silla 1 u 1 u 2 u
Mecedora 1 u 1 u 3 u
Silln 1 u 2 u 5 u
Situacin a Resolver
Planteo del problema
Funcin
Objetivo
Restricciones
21 24 36 Z x y z = + +
400
2 500
2 3 5 1450
0
0
x y z
x y z
x y z
x
y
+ + s

+ + s

+ + s

>

>

Vamos a
Excel a
ingresar estos
datos
Cules de los siguientes resultados es el correcto?
) 200 300 100 540 b x y z Z = = = =
) 0 300 100 10.800 c x y z Z = = = =
) 300 100 100 0 a x y z Z = = = =
INCORRECTO!!!

Volv a Excel e intentalo de
nuevo
Microsoft Excel
VOLVER
MUY BIEN!!!
Has alcanzado los
objetivos de esta
unidad!!!!
I ntegracin y Fijacin
Una compaa de cargas maneja envos para dos
compaas A y B. La empresa A enva cajas que pesan 3 kg
cada una y tienen un volumen de 2 m
3
, mientras qie la B
enva cajas de 1 m
3
con un peso de 5 kg. Tanto A como B
hacen envos a los mismos destinos y el costo de transporte
de la caja de A es $ 0,75 y para B de $ 0,50. La compaa
transportadora tiene un camin con espacio de carga para
2.400 m
3
y capacidad mxima de 9.200 kg. En un viaje,
Cuntas cajas de cada empresa debe transportar el
camin para que la compaa de transportes obtenga el
mximo de ingresos? Cul es este mximo?

Resolveremos el mismo problema de optimizacin
mediante todos los mtodos aprendidos

Cul de los siguientes planteos es
correcto?
Funcin Objetivo:
0, 75 0, 50
Restricciones:
2 2400
3 5 9200
Z x y
x y
x y
= +
+ s

+ s

Funcin Objetivo:
2400 9200
Restricciones:
2 3 0, 75
5 0, 50
Z x y
x y
x y
= +
+ s

+ s

INCORRECTO!!!

Volv a leer el problema y
pens bien cules son las
variables principales
Volv a pensarlo
Muy Bien!!!!
Ahora debemos graficar el problema para
ver que tipo de regin de soluciones
factibles obtenemos
Regin de
soluciones
factibles
Es una regin acotada? SI NO
INCORRECTO!!!
Record que
Ahora volv a pensarlo
Muy Bien!!!!
Ahora debemos encontrar los
cuatro vrtices de esa regin
B = (0,1840)
A = (0,0)
C = ?
D = (1200,0)
Puntos Esquina
Coordenadas del punto C
Vamos a Excel a resolver el correspondiente sistema de
ecuaciones para encontrar las coordenadas de C y
luego a buscar en cul de los puntos es mxima la
funcin objetivo
Microsoft Excel
Ahora verifiquemos si esa solucin
coincide con la que nos brinda el
comando Solver
Microsoft Excel
Cul de las siguientes respuestas
es correcta?

El camin debe transportar 1100 cajas de la empresa A
y 1600 cajas de la empresa B para que los ingresos sean
mximos, y el mximo es de $ 400.

El ingreso mximo es de 1100 + 400 + 1600 = 3100.

El camin debe transportar 400 cajas de la empresa A y
1600 cajas de la empresa B para que los ingresos sean
mximos, y el mximo es de $ 1100.

Ninguna de las anteriores.

INCORRECTO!!!

Volv a pensarlo
VOLVER
Muy Bien!!!
Has finalizado las clases de
Programacin Lineal con
xito, Felicitaciones!!
FI N

Das könnte Ihnen auch gefallen